Just in time for the Red Bull District Ride the FMBA was raffling off a VIP package with very special features among all existing and new FMBA members.
Birgitte from Norway was the one to win it - Here´s what she experienced:

"When the FMBA called me that Tuesday afternoon to tell me I won the VIP package for the Red Bull District Ride I was really suprised. When I thought about who to take along, the first person I thought of was my sister Eline and I couldn’t have asked for better company. 

So we already left on Thursday: Out of freezing Norway into spending an adventourus weekend in Nuremberg, Germany to see the best riders in the world compete on this crazy course - We couldn’t wait and couldn't believe that we were now on our way to the final event of the FMB World Tour.
When we got to Nuremberg, the FMBA welcomed us at the train station and brought us over to our Hotel leaving us with a welcome package, a little time to rest and loads to look forward to.
After that we went straight to the Best Trick competion. The jumps were huge and it was so much fun to watch all the riders. Andreu’s Superman was insane and we knew that this was just the beginning of a great weekend.
After the contest we went to a VIP BBQ with plenty of really good food and even a few of the riders showed up for a chat and to give us a little inside information of what to expect.

Unfortunately, Eline woke up with a fever on Saturday so we missed the course walk with Timo Pritzel and the visit to the riders lounge. That sucked, but after some sleep and a few pills from the pharmacy she felt better and was ready to watch the finals.
The whole city was so packed with spectators that it was difficult to walk around, but we had a great view from the Friends of Red Bull Area right by the Best Trick jump. The rest of the course was shown on a big screen right next to it. The riding was really impressive! The course was so different from any other competition I’ve ever seen and the atmosphere was breath taking.
What a brilliant finish to the FMB World Tour!  

We left Nuremberg on Sunday after a great after show party and I can truly say we had an excellent time.
Thank you FMBA for this fantastic trip to the FMB World Tour finals!"
